The Criticality of Regular Tire Reviews for Safety
Periodic tire checks play a key role in maintaining vehicle safety, as they can stop accidents caused by tire failures. These inspections involve checking for tread wear, air pressure, and visible damages such as cuts or bulges. Sustaining proper tire pressure is necessary; under-inflated tires can lead to blowouts, while over-inflated tires may diminish traction. Additionally, evaluating tread depth is key for effective grip, particularly in adverse weather conditions.
Consistent inspections can also identify uneven wear patterns, which might point to alignment or suspension issues. Addressing these problems promptly can boost vehicle performance and extend tire lifespan. Moreover, routine checks foster a habit of proactive vehicle maintenance, reinforcing overall driving safety. By making tire inspections a priority, vehicle owners can significantly diminish the risk of tire-related incidents and ensure a safer driving experience for themselves, their passengers, and others on the road.

Methods to Correctly Install Tires for Optimal Operation
Correct tire installation is vital for achieving maximum vehicle performance and safety. To start, it is important to select the appropriate tire measurement and type, as specified in the vehicle's manual. Prior to installation, the technician should inspect the wheel for defects or corrosion, confirming a proper fit. The tire should be mounted on the wheel, aligning the valve stem with the designated area. Then, it is necessary to balance the tire to prevent vibrations that can affect handling and wear. Proper torque specifications must be followed when tightening lug nuts, usually in a crisscross pattern to ensure even related article pressure. After installation, checking the tire pressure is crucial, as both overinflation and underinflation can cause handling problems and reduced fuel efficiency. Finally, a test drive can help confirm that the tires are installed properly, allowing the driver to experience optimal performance and safety on the road.

Importance of Tire Turning
Consistent tire rotation is a key aspect of vehicle maintenance that greatly extends the lifespan of tires. This technique involves periodically rotating the placement of each tire to confirm uniform wear across all four tires. As tires wear differently depending on their location—front tires often bearing more weight and experiencing different forces than rear tires—rotation maintains balanced tread depth. This not only improves traction and handling but also increases fuel efficiency. Additionally, regular rotations can prevent costly tire replacements and boost overall safety by reducing the risk of blowouts. Ultimately, following a tire rotation schedule is critical for peak vehicle performance and longevity, making it a critical component of complete tire care.

Tread Depth Indicators
How can motorists guarantee their tires stay secure and effective on the road? Monitoring tread depth is essential. Tread depth gauges, often integrated in tires, serve as a critical guide. A standard practice is to replace tires when tread depth hits 2/32 of an inch, as inadequate tread compromises traction, particularly in wet conditions. Drivers can also try the penny test; inserting a penny into the tread with Lincoln's head facing down can show whether the tread is sufficient. If the top of Lincoln's head is apparent, it is time for new tires. Frequently monitoring tread depth not only enhances safety but also improves vehicle performance, guaranteeing ideal handling and braking capabilities.
Visual Deterioration Symptoms
Frequent monitoring of tread depth is important, but visual damage signs can also indicate when tires need replacement. Cracks, bulges, or blisters on the tire surface often signal serious structural issues. Uneven wear patterns may suggest misalignment or other mechanical problems, necessitating immediate attention. Additionally, embedded foreign objects, such as nails or stones, can compromise tire integrity. If the tires exhibit excessive sidewall damage or significant wear indicators, it is vital to contemplate replacement for safety. Moreover, age can also affect tire performance; tires older than six years should be evaluated regardless of tread condition. Regular inspections for these visual damage signs help guarantee peak performance and safety on the road. Ignoring them could lead to hazardous driving conditions.
Tire Maintenance Advice for Maximizing Life Span and Performance
Proper tire care can greatly enhance both the lifespan and efficiency of a car's tires. Regularly checking tire pressure is crucial, as improperly inflated tires can lead to uneven wear and reduced fuel efficiency. Maintaining the proper pressure, as specified by the maker, guarantees ideal contact with the road.
Furthermore, rotating tires every 5,000 to 7,500 miles can encourage even wear and prolong their lifespan. Drivers should also examine tread depth regularly; a depth of 2/32 inches or less indicates it's time for new tires.
Furthermore, proper alignment and balancing help prevent early wear and boost handling. Keeping tires clean and free of debris can similarly help to their overall health. Additionally, avoiding rough driving patterns, like quick acceleration and sudden braking, will not only improve tire longevity but also improve the vehicle’s overall performance. By following these care recommendations, drivers can maximize both longevity and efficiency.

May I combine different Tire manufacturers on My Car?
Pairing different tire manufacturers on a vehicle is generally not preferred. Differences in tread design, rubber compounds, and performance characteristics can produce uneven wear and compromised handling, potentially affecting safety and overall driving experience.
